Anthony Edwards Generates Over 100M Views On NBA Platforms Since Start Of Playoffs

May 2, 2024 1:09 AM

Anthony Edwards has generated over 100 million views across the NBA's social and digital platforms since the start of the playoffs, according to the league's communications department.

The number only trails LeBron James with 130 million views.

Edwards was the seventh most-viewed player on the league's digital platforms during the regular season.

Edwards has also gained the most Instagram followers among players since the start of the playoffs.

The Timberwolves open their second round series against the Nuggets on Saturday.

Chris Finch Planning To Be With Timberwolves For Game 1

May 2, 2024 12:58 AM

Chris Finch is planning to be on the Minnesota Timberwolves' sideline for Game 1 of their series against the Denver Nuggets.

Finch had surgery to repair a ruptured patellar tendon in his right knee on Wednesday.

Assistant Micah Nori is taking over head coaching duties in Finch's absence.

Due to a lack of spacing on the bench, Finch may switch seats with athletic trainer Gregg Farnam on the sideline for increased leg room.

Mike Conley Named 23-24 NBA Teammate Of The Year

May 1, 2024 12:40 PM

Mike Conley has been named the 2023-24 Twyman-Stokes Teammate of the Year.  Conley has won the annual award for the second time, having previously earned the honor in the 2018-19 season. 

The Twyman-Stokes Teammate of the Year Award recognizes the player deemed the best teammate based on selfless play, on- and off-court leadership as a mentor and role model to other NBA players, and commitment and dedication to team.

Conley finished first ahead of Mikal Bridges and Jalen Brunson.

Jrue Holiday had won the award three out of the past four seasons.

Chris Finch To Have Patellar Tendon Surgery Wednesday

Apr 30, 2024 9:50 AM

Minnesota Timberwolves head coach Chris Finch will have surgery for a ruptured right patellar tendon on Wednesday. Finch was injured near the end of the Timberwolves Game 4 victory over the Phoenix Suns. Minnesota guard Mike Conley collided with Finch on a play near the sideline.

Finch's status to be on the bench for Game 1 of the Wolves second round series against the Denver Nuggets is unknown. Finch may have to coach the game from the locker room, sending his plans to the assistants on the bench. Minnesota is expecting their coach to be able to travel to Denver for Game 1, barring any unexpected complications.

Finch led the Timberwolves to the second-most wins they've had in regular season franchise history. Minnesota's sweep of the Suns was only the second time in which the team has won a first round series.

Karl-Anthony Towns Calls Anthony Edwards 'The Face Of The League'

Apr 29, 2024 9:08 AM

In the postgame media session after the Minnesota Timberwolves swept the Phoenix Suns, Wolves franchise star Karl-Anthony Towns had high praise for Anthony Edwards.

"He’s the face of the league. I’ve been saying that. He hates when I say it, but it’s true," Towns on Edwards' place in the NBA.

Minnesota's young star also drew high praise from Suns forward Kevin Durant.

"I’m so impressed with Ant. So impressed with Ant," Durant said about Edwards. "My favorite player to watch. Just grown so much since he came into the league."

 Edwards scored 40 points in helping the Timberwolves to close out the Suns in four games. He shot 13-of-20 from the floor, including 7-of-13 from behind the arc. Edwards added nine rebounds, six assists, two blocks and a steal to his big scoring line.

Naz Reid Narrowly Beats Out Malik Monk To Win 23-24 NBA Sixth Man Of The Year

Apr 24, 2024 7:03 PM

Naz Reid has been named the 2023-24 NBA Sixth Man of the Year.

Reid finished with 352 points, ahead of Malik Monk with 342 points. Reid received 45 first place votes, while Monk had 43. Reid and Monk each had 39 second place votes and 10 third place votes.

Bobby Portis Jr., Norman Powell and Bogdan Bogdanovic round out the top-5.

In his fifth NBA season, Reid established himself as the top reserve man in the league, appearing in a career-high 81 games, averaging career-highs across the board, including 13.5 points, 5.2 rebounds and 1.3 assists per game. He finished the 2023-24 campaign shooting 47.7% (406-of-851) from the field, including a career-high 41.4% (169-of-408) from three.

Wolves To Have Mediation On Ownership Dispute On May 1st

Apr 22, 2024 10:05 PM

The Minnesota Timberwolves' ongoing ownership dispute will have an initial mediation session on May 1st. 

Glen Taylor voided a deal to sell a majority stake in the Wolves to a group led by Marc Lore and Alex Rodriguez after he asserted they failed to meet contractual deadlines.

Lore and Rodriguez are disputing Taylor's position as they attempt to finalize their purchase of the Wolves. 

Lore and Rodriguez agreed to purchase the Wolves in 2021 at a valuation of $1.5 billion. The deal allowed them to purchase 20 percent of the team in July 2021, 20 percent more in 2022 and 40 percent more in 2023.

2023-24 Coach Of The Year Finalists Announced

Apr 21, 2024 7:48 PM

The NBA announced the finalists for 2023-24 Coach of the Year. The finalists are Mark Daigneault of the Oklahoma City Thunder, Chris Finch of the Minnesota Timberwolves and Jamahl Mosley of the Orlando Magic.

Daigneault led the Thunder to the best regular season record in the Western Conference. Oklahoma City improved from 40 wins and losing in the Play-In Tournament to 57 wins and the top seed in the playoffs.

Finch guided the Timberwolves from 42 wins and the eighth seed to 56 wins and the third seed in the Western Conference.

Mosley led the Magic to the first playoff appearance since 2020. Orlando improved from 22 wins in 2021-22 to 34 wins last season to 47 wins this season. The Magic also won the Southeast Division for the first time since 2018-19.

2023-24 Sixth Man Of The Year Finalists Announced

Apr 21, 2024 7:41 PM

The NBA announced the finalists for 2023-24 Sixth Man of the Year. The finalists are Malik Monk of the Sacramento Kings, Bobby Portis of the Milwaukee Bucks and Naz Reid of the Minnesota Timberwolves.

All three players are first-time finalists for Sixth Man of the Year.
